What's Happening?
The San Diego Padres capitalized on strong pitching to secure a 1-0 victory against the Atlanta Braves, with Michael King delivering seven scoreless innings. This win marks a positive turn for the Padres, who have been struggling with inconsistent starting
pitching. The game was decided by a home run from Manny Machado in the fourth inning. The Padres are now looking to build on this momentum as they continue their series against the Braves, with Griffin Canning set to pitch in the next game.
